Major Traffic Jam on Eastbound 91 Freeway

Cerritos, June 21, 2025 -

A traffic collision on the Eastbound 91 Freeway near the Interstate 605 junction in Cerritos, CA, caused significant traffic disruptions today. The incident involved a single vehicle, a gray Ford F150, which lost control and ended up blocking the right lanes of the freeway.

The collision occurred early this morning, leading to a complete stoppage of all lanes on the Eastbound 91 Freeway. This resulted in considerable backup and congestion for commuters during the busy morning hours. Traffic management units were dispatched to the scene to assist with traffic control and to facilitate the clearing of the roadway.

A tow truck was called to remove the disabled vehicle, which was facing sideways and obstructing traffic. Emergency responders worked diligently to manage the situation and restore normal traffic flow.
